#3a6968 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3a6968 is composed of 22.7% red, 41.2% green and 40.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 1% yellow and 58.8% black. It has a hue angle of 178.7 degrees, a saturation of 28.8% and a lightness of 32%. #3a6968 color hex could be obtained by blending #74d2d0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

#3a6968 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3a6968 has RGB values of R:58, G:105, B:104 and CMYK values of C:0.45, M:0, Y:0.01, K:0.59. Its decimal value is 3828072.
